#1e62e4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e62e4 is composed of 11.8% red, 38.4%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.8% cyan, 57%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 219.4 degrees, a saturation of 78.6% and a lightness of 50.6%. #1e62e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#3cc4ff with #0000c9.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#1e62e4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1e62e4 has RGB values of R:30, G:98,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 1991396.

Shades and Tints of #1e62e4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000103 is the darkest color, while #f0f5f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1e62e4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f8083 is the less saturated color, while #0b5cf7 is the most saturated one.
